Output 35836997fae64574c8752035668e5df5ab1289bb8429443a3e213d3e2a03ac9e:30

value
151576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7892c71a38669170881c1707e4b6090c205c1e0c OP_EQUAL
address
3CgYqrpjetEhEzszSAaBBn8mATswWi5s4u
transaction
35836997fae64574c8752035668e5df5ab1289bb8429443a3e213d3e2a03ac9e
spent
true